2035 Westwood Boulevard Suite 101
Los Angeles, CA
18780 Cox Avenue
Saratoga, CA
5308 West Main Street
Belleville, IL
4190 City Avenue
Philadelphia, PA
9750 3rd Avenue Neste Northeast Suite 100
Seattle, WA
Below is a list of contact lens companies located in Illinois, USA, serving cities such as Hinsdale, Auburn, Burr Ridge, and more. Click on a city name for full listings